2010-11-11 4 views
4

Можно создать дубликат:
Lightweight servlet engine for serving java application via IISможно запустить JSP-файлы на сервере IIS

Это можно запустить JSP-файлы, скажем, Struts 1, на сервере IIS?

Благодаря

+0

Возможный дубликат [Легкий сервлет-механизм для обслуживания приложения Java через IIS] (http://stackoverflow.com/q/1344289/), [Запуск Java-приложения в IIS] (http://stackoverflow.com/ q/2256084 /) – outis

+0

Вот описание того, как использовать IIS с Tomcat для этого: [Tomcat IIS HowTo] (http://tomcat.apache.org/tomcat-3.3-doc/tomcat-iis-howto.html) – kmote

ответ

0

Не без сервлетов/JSP двигатель некоторого вида.

6

David Wang написал сообщение в блогах MSDN под названием «How does JSP work on IIS?», в котором рассматривается, почему JSP нельзя запускать непосредственно под IIS 5.0 и 6.0. Краткая версия заключается в том, что IIS не запускает динамический контент напрямую, для этого требуется надстройка (даже ASP.Net). В статье упоминается популярное дополнение для использования сервлетов - isapi_redirect, которое шунтирует запрос Tomcat для обработки (поскольку isapi_redirect является надстройкой IIS, IIS по-прежнему обрабатывает связь с клиентом).

+0

Я прочел эту ссылку, но мне интересно, какое дополнение мне нужно. Я бы предпочел ответить кому-то, у кого есть опыт в этом. Спасибо – CristiC

+0

Вам нужно будет получить ** isapi_redirect ** Tomcat ** (по ссылке). –

Смежные вопросы